F&M, Extending Reach in Wisconsin, Announces 3d '96 Deal

F&M Bancorp. has spent 1996 gobbling up small banks across Wisconsin.

The $1.1 billion-asset banking company on Oct. 16 announced a letter of intent to buy Prairie City Bank, Prairie du Chien. The acquisition announcement was the third of the year for Kaukauna-based F&M - all stock- swap deals. Terms were not released.

F&M is looking to build its presence in key sections of the state, a bank spokeswoman said. The $85 million-asset Prairie City is located in a commercial area on the Mississippi River in southwestern Wisconsin; the other pending acquisitions, State Bank of East Troy and Brodhead-based Green County Bank, are in southern Wisconsin.

The company acquired three Wisconsin banks last year, said Linda K. Seefeldt, vice president of marketing.

"We look for communities that are strong," she said.
